What is a potential drawback of using computer-generated passwords?

Explanation:
The potential drawback of using computer-generated passwords is that they may be too random for users to recall. Computer-generated passwords are designed to be highly secure by incorporating a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ters, often leading to very complex strings. While this complexity enhances security, it can also make these passwords difficult for users to remember, especially if they are not familiar with strategies for managing complex passwords. Users often struggle with recalling such random, high-security passwords without the aid of password managers, which could lead to frustration and, paradoxically, increase the risk of poor password practices, such as writing them down or reusing them. This challenge highlights a fundamental tension in password security: the need for robust passwords that are also manageable for users.
